Very pretty and modern room, but tiny! Would be ok for a 1 night stay.
We stayed in a room with a double and single bed. There was an awkward support wall between the two, so not much space to move around. The bathroom was tiny and water from the sink or shower would end up everywhere.
The corridors are so narrow and the lifts tiny, so walking with a compact stroller and a suitcase was challenging.
No basics like face cloth, cotton face pads, etc. which we needed as we packed light. Also no phone in the room - you what’s app reception but sometime don’t get a response for hours.
Good proximity to train stations, Kensington park, restaurants and grocery stores.
Overall very pretty but too small for longer stays.
